Using Microsoft Windows 7? Here’s why you should upgrade to Windows 10 soon…

Microsoft’s support for Windows 7 will end on January 14, 2020. Now is the ideal opportunity to implement a plan to upgrade your computer system, maximising the strength of your machine’s security.
